TextMate searches for bundle stuff in the following order:

1) ~/Library/Application Support/TextMate/Bundles    (in your home  
directory, most commonly occurring if you make changes to the file  
using the bundle editor)
2) /Library/Application Support/TextMate/Bundles   (This is usually  
the recommended target for svn checkouts)
3) /Application/TextMate.app/Contents/SharedSupport/Bundles (The one  
shipping with TextMate, typically somewhat outdated)
